Gaelic Football

The St. Aidan’s Gaelic football teams have once again started off the year extremely well. The Under 14’shave reached the Dublin ‘A’ Semi-Final recording 3emphatic victories along the way. They have played fantastic football scoring a total of 9-31 in 3 games, while showing great skill, pride, grit and determination. This is a team that can go all the way and establish themselves as a serious force to be reckoned with in Dublin schools GAA. The Under 16’s have started off this years campaign with an impressive victory away to St. David’s. Theteam displayed a great team spirit and won by 8 points.

A couple more performances like that would spell success for St. Aidan’s once again. The Senior footballers have begun training recently fortheir championship and great things is expected ofthem this year. They are a very motivated bunch ofplayers who have the skills and the mindset to go all the way. The 1st year football championship will begin after Christmas and in first year this year there is a talented group of players waiting patiently for a crack at the title.

Congratulations

Congratulations to Seán Kenna (6West) who recently finished 3rd in the Annual Liffey Swim. Seán recently picked up his first cap for the Irish SeniorWater Polo Team and he is also the captain of the schools SeniorWater Polo team.And to cap a wonderful few months Seán was awarded Evening Herald "Sportstar of the Week" and will be honoured at a lavish ceremony in Croke Park next May.
